问题现象: | 在存货核算中,进行各种单据修改时,提示:单据保存失败,无法将CHAR值转换为MONEY,该CHAR值的语法有误,修改单据失败! 该问题在所有的机器上都存在。 |
问题原因: | 已采用方法: 1、 重新安装数据库 2、 检查相关的机器名称或区域日期格式等环境设置 3、 重新安装服务器 经过分析后发现是数据库视图中的KCOTHERINH表的时间戳有问题,最后怀疑是感染病毒造成的。 |
解决方案: | 最终解决方法:: 视图:kcotherinh(其他出、入库单)上时间戳语句有问题: 用查询分析器打开此视图,将原来的: convert(char,convert(datetime,dbo.rdrecord.ufts),121) as ufts 替换成正确的: convert(char,convert(money,dbo.rdrecord.ufts),2) as ufts 这样处理后就可以修改保存了。 |
相关补丁: | |
版本: | 8.52 |
模块: | 存货核算 |
产品: | V852 |
问题名称: | 单据修改时,提示:单据保存失败,无法将CHAR值转换为MONEY |
最后更新: | 2006-03-10 00:00:00 |